Associate Researcher | Zhejiang University | China

Dr. Xinyu An is an Associate Researcher at the Ocean College, Zhejiang University, specializing in underwater robotics, autonomous underwater vehicles, and intelligent control systems. He holds engineering degrees through the doctoral level with specialization in mechanical and marine engineering, supported by rigorous training in robotics design and optimization. His professional experience includes leading and contributing to advanced research projects on seabed-operating autonomous systems, digital twin platforms, and multi-sensor control architectures, while actively participating in team leadership and collaborative innovation. His research focuses on underwater vehicle design, control system development, computational fluid dynamics, digital twins, and artificial intelligence, with peer-reviewed publications contributing to both theoretical and applied advancements in marine robotics. His scholarly impact includes 69 citations across 10 indexed documents with an h-index of 5, complemented by competitive research grants, active professional memberships, and recognized service to the academic community through research collaboration and scholarly dissemination.

Director | Shandong University | China

Prof. Qie Sun, Professor and doctoral supervisor at Shandong University and Deputy Dean of the Institute for Advanced Technology, is a leading expert in sustainable energy systems, thermal science, and integrated energy system optimization. He holds a doctorate in Industrial Ecology from the Royal Institute of Technology and bachelor’s and master’s degrees in management from Ocean University of China. His professional experience encompasses academic leadership roles, major interdisciplinary collaborations, and the management of high-impact projects in multi-energy systems, CO₂ capture and utilization, thermal management technologies, and energy storage solutions. He has led and contributed to numerous national and provincial research initiatives and played a key role in the thermal control research of the Alpha Magnetic Spectrometer. His research focuses on integrated energy systems, system flexibility under uncertainty, multi-energy coupling modeling, thermal management for electronics and wearable devices, urban energy systems, and industrial ecology, supported by extensive scholarly output that includes over 140 documents, 5,302 citations, and an h-index of 33. Prof. Sun has received multiple honors, including global top scientist recognitions, best paper awards, outstanding reviewer awards, and teaching excellence distinctions. He serves as Assistant Editor of Advances in Applied Energy, Associate Editor for several prominent journals, reviewer for numerous high-impact publications, and an active member of professional bodies such as IEEE and the Chinese Society of Engineering Thermophysics. Through his editorial leadership, scientific committee roles, and contributions to international conferences, Prof. Sun continues to advance innovation and global scholarship in sustainable energy research.
